We need to support multiple versions of external-arm-toolchain, partly as different versions have different layouts on disk, and partly because 11.2 doesn't work on pre-Broadwell hardware. Rename this recipe so the version is in the filename, and dynamically set PKGV instead of PV so PREFERRED_VERSION is easier to use.
